Therefore, writes made by `T::bios_limit` go to this temporary instead of the memory location pointed to by `limit`. Additionally, `limit` may be uninitialized, such as when `Registration::bios_limit_callback` is invoked by `show_bios_limit` in dr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c. Therefore dereferencing `limit` is unsound. Fix this by changing the signature of `T::bios_limit` to return the limit value. `Registration::bios_limit_callback` can then update `limit` directly.
